What you'll see and do
Buffalo Trace Distillery
Experience the rich heritage and exceptional craftsmanship of Buffalo Trace Distillery, one of the oldest continuously operating distilleries in America. Nestled in the heart of Frankfort, Kentucky, Buffalo Trace offers an immersive journey through the history and production of some of the world’s finest bourbons. Bulleit Distilling Co Visitor Experience
Immerse yourself in the bold flavors and rich history of Bulleit Distilling Co. Located in Shelbyville, Kentucky, Bulleit is known for its high-rye content bourbon and innovative spirit. Best Bourbon Trail Experience — Ask for Bruce
Had an amazing time on our bourbon trail private tour! Our guide Bruce was incredibly knowledgeable and truly a bourbon expert — you could tell this is a genuine passion for him, not just a job. We visited Buffalo Trace, Bluegrass Distillers, and Bulleit, and Bruce handled all the scheduling, making sure we were exactly where we needed to be at every stop without ever feeling rushed. What really stood out was the flexibility built into the day. Bruce was happy to adjust the itinerary to check out a few extra spots along the way, which made the whole experience feel personalized. We had a great time bouncing between distilleries, learning the history and process behind each one. Overall, this was a fantastic experience from start to finish. Bruce went the extra mile to make sure we enjoyed ourselves at every turn, and it showed. He even brought homemade bourbon balls which were incredible! Highly recommend this tour to anyone looking to explore the bourbon trail with a fun guide who really knows their stuff.
